About Drunk Driving Law in Chiang Rai, Thailand:

Drunk driving, also known as driving under the influence (DUI) or driving while intoxicated (DWI), is a serious offense in Chiang Rai, Thailand. It is illegal to operate a motor vehicle with a blood alcohol concentration (BAC) of 0.05% or higher. Penalties for drunk driving can range from fines and license suspension to imprisonment, depending on the severity of the offense.

Local Laws Overview:

In Chiang Rai, Thailand, the legal BAC limit for drivers is 0.05%. Law enforcement officials conduct random breath tests and checkpoints to catch drunk drivers. If you are caught driving under the influence, you may face fines, license suspension, and even imprisonment. Repeat offenders may face harsher penalties.

Q: Can I refuse a breath test in Chiang Rai, Thailand?

A: Refusing a breath test in Chiang Rai, Thailand can result in additional penalties, including license suspension or revocation. It is advisable to comply with law enforcement requests during a traffic stop.
